What is a CS2 Gambling Site?
A CS2 gambling site is an online platform where users can bet virtual items-- mostly CS2 weapon skins, cases, and keys-- or cryptocurrency and fiat currency on games of opportunity. Unlike traditional online gambling establishments, these platforms incorporate directly with the Steam community or crypto-wallets, allowing players to deposit their digital stock in exchange for site credits.
These platforms operate in a special grey location of the internet. While they stand out from conventional, state-regulated online casinos, many have actually progressed to execute robust security procedures, provably fair algorithms, and rigorous compliance procedures.
Popular Games Found on CS2 Gambling Sites
CS2 gambling platforms include a wide range of video game modes. Some are adjusted from traditional gambling establishment games, while others were customized particularly for the Counter-Strike skin-trading community.
Here are the most common video games found on these platforms:
- Crash: A multiplier starts at 1.00 x and quickly increases. Gamers need to cash out before the graph randomly "crashes." If they stop working to squander in time, they lose their wager.
- Case Opening: Simulates the in-game case opening experience however often features custom-made, higher-value chances or specialized community-made cases containing unusual knives and gloves.
- Live roulette: Similar to conventional gambling establishment live roulette, gamers bank on colors (generally red, black, and green) where the winning result is determined by a spinning wheel.
- Coinflip: A traditional 1v1 game mode where 2 gamers wager skins of approximately equal worth. A digital coin is turned, and the winner takes the entire pot.
- Jackpot: Multiple players deposit skins into a main pool. A winner is drawn arbitrarily; the greater the value of the skins deposited, the higher the player's analytical chance of winning the whole pool.
- Mines: A grid-based video game where players uncover tiles, trying to avoid covert "mines" to multiply their payout.

Risks and Safety Precautions
Engaging with CS2 gambling websites brings fundamental risks. Due to the fact that virtual skins hold real-world monetary value, gamers need to work out caution to safeguard their digital assets and monetary wellness.
Possible Risks to Keep in Mind:
- The House Edge: Just like traditional gambling establishments, CS2 gambling websites are companies designed to earn a profit with time. The chances always prefer your home.
- Skin Valuation Fluctuations: Skin rates vary based upon market supply, need, and Valve updates.
- Scam and Phishing Sites: Fake clones of popular gambling websites often appear to take Steam login information or deposit skins without crediting the user.
- Regulative Uncertainty: Depending on your jurisdiction, online gambling-- particularly skin gambling-- might be restricted or outright illegal.
Finest Practices for Safe Gambling:
- Never Gamble More Than You Can Afford to Lose: Treat gambling strictly as a form of paid entertainment, not a reliable method to make cash.
- Double-Check URLs: Always bookmark main websites to prevent falling victim to phishing frauds through sponsored online search engine advertisements.
-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Secure both your Steam account and any associated crypto-wallets with strong 2FA.
- Be careful of "Rigged" Bot Promises: Be exceptionally doubtful of individuals on social networks declaring they can ensure wins on specific websites or control algorithms.
